It's more the other way around - the 605 and 705 are fitness units with navigation as a bonus. I think very few people actually even care too terribly much about that. From what I've heard, most people seem to say they would occasionally use it, but it's not that useful. The exciting part of the 705 is power measurement.
Also worth noting that they have larger, color screens than the 305 while still claiming better battery life, which was a major issue with 305's, especially the early ones.
What I wish Garmin would make is a more truly multisport computer. I've not played with the Forerunner series, but I still feel like the Edge is too cycling oriented and the Forerunner is too running oriented. If they folded a few more of the running features (like switching sports profiles on the unit, foot pod) into the 705 I'd have bought one in a heartbeat. Some sort of swimming support would be cool too, but not likely.
